WebAcute Pancreatitis. Acute pancreatitis is acute inflammation of the pancreas (and, sometimes, adjacent tissues). The most common triggers are gallstones and alcohol … WebMild attacks account for 70–80% of acute pancreatitis admissions. The remaining 20–30% of patients are admitted with severe pancreatitis with reported mortality rates of up to … WebThe causal relationship between alcohol abuse and pancreatitis is undisputed. However, why some alcoholics manifest pancreatitis whereas others do not remains unexplained. Epidemiological data increasingly point toward an adjuvant role for genetic, dietary, and environmental factors. Significant adv … c5 corvette hats for sale
